Oostmaaslaan 293
Apartment at Oostmaaslaan 293 in Rotterdam (Struisenburg neighbourhood). The home was built in 1979 and has 68 m² of living space, 2 bedrooms and energy label C. The nearest railway station is Gerdesiaweg (693 m). The nearest primary school is Nieuwe Park Rozenburgschool (544 m).
